Understanding the Burberry Brand and its Pricing Strategy:
Before diving into specific price points, it's crucial to understand what contributes to Burberry's premium pricing. The brand's high cost isn't simply about the fabric; it encompasses a complex interplay of factors:
* Heritage and Brand Recognition: Burberry's long history and global recognition significantly influence its pricing. The brand's legacy and association with luxury translate into a higher perceived value.
* High-Quality Materials: Burberry often uses premium materials like Egyptian cotton, fine silks, and luxurious cashmere blends. These fabrics are inherently more expensive than those used in mass-market brands. The superior quality results in a softer feel, greater durability, and a more refined drape.
* Craftsmanship and Manufacturing: Burberry shirts are meticulously crafted, often employing traditional tailoring techniques. The attention to detail, from stitching to finishing, contributes to the overall cost. Many shirts are manufactured in facilities adhering to strict quality control standards, further adding to the expense.
* Design and Innovation: Burberry's design teams constantly innovate, incorporating modern trends while maintaining the brand's classic aesthetic. This creative process, involving designers, pattern makers, and sample makers, is a significant cost factor.
* Retail Markups: The retail price of a Burberry shirt includes markups applied by retailers themselves. These markups cover operating costs, profit margins, and other expenses incurred by the store. The location of the retailer (e.g., a high-end department store versus an online retailer) also affects the final price.
* Import Duties and Taxes: Because Burberry is a British brand, importing its products into South Africa incurs import duties and taxes. These additional costs are passed on to the consumer, impacting the final price. Fluctuations in exchange rates between the South African Rand (ZAR) and the British Pound (GBP) or the US dollar (USD) can further influence the price.
Burberry Shirts for Men Price:
The price of a Burberry men's shirt varies significantly depending on several factors:
* Fabric: A pure cotton shirt will generally be less expensive than one made from a silk blend or cashmere. Shirts featuring unique or innovative fabric treatments will command higher prices.
* Style: A classic Oxford shirt will typically be priced lower than a more elaborate design, such as a shirt with intricate embroidery, unique collar styles, or distinctive detailing.
* Seasonality: New collections and limited-edition pieces are often priced higher than standard styles. Seasonal sales and promotions can offer opportunities to purchase Burberry shirts at discounted prices.
* Retailer: The retailer selling the shirt influences the price. Luxury department stores may have higher markups than online retailers or outlet stores.
